Class Poem | Class Poem by Arlene Tyndall 9-2 We pupils entered Smedley, Three short years ago. Many filled with happiness, Many filled with woe. Not knowing what we’d have to face, We stepped into these walls. All of us then settled down, Within its study halls. We learned about democracy, And also right from wrong, We also learned that life was work And not all play and song. To some school may be just all work To others just something to do, To me it’s something priceless, And it should mean the same to you. Some think that school is just a grind, But in future years to come, Most of us will realize That school was always fun. We thought that some of the teachers were very mean, To make us study hard, To other students they might seem Just like a prison guard. But now as we’re departing, We have a heavy heart, Because too late we realize, We loved Smedley from the start. We’ll miss it during coming years, And wish that we were here. Then, my friends, we’ll realize, To our hearts it was always dear. |
